The recommended tire pressure for the BMW HP2 Megamoto 2007 is 2.5 bar (36 psi) for the front tire and 2.9 bar (42 psi) for the rear tire.
It is recommended to change the oil every 6,000 miles (10,000 km) or once a year, whichever comes first.
The BMW HP2 Megamoto 2007 requires SAE 15W-50 synthetic motorcycle oil for optimal performance.
